... Btw apexlater do you have any suspension mods down to your car or are you running stock suspension? i have access to the alignment rack at work and plan on toying around with some toe setups and was going to try the setup you posted and see how it works.


I am running the stock suspension...actually, the whole car is stock except for the pads and airfilter...wheels and tires of course.

WARNING: That is not a good street alignment at all!!! It is way too darty, the back end floats at high speeds, and it will chew up your tires faster than you can save money for a new set.

I was so tired last night I didn't put everything back to zero and it sucked commuting to work this morning, and I'm sure my tires aren't happy about it.
